TO: Mayor and City Council
FROM: James V. Capparelli, City Manager
SUBJECT:
title
Award of Professional Services Agreement for the 2023 Lift Station Rehabilitation Program to Donohue & Associates in the amount of $89,900.00
end
BACKGROUND:
In the spring of 2021, the City prepared a request for qualifications (RFQ) for a multi-phased lift station assessment, evaluation, and design engineering program. Fifteen proposals were received, and staff selected seven engineering firms to interview. Staff ranked Trotter and Associates Inc. as the most qualified engineering firm. Ranked as a close second place firms were Strand Associates, Inc. and Donahue & Associates, Inc. On June 16, 2021, the City Council approved a contract with Trotter and Associates Inc. for the Phase I Lift Station assessment portion of the program. The scope of the Phase I project included completing a detailed inventory and condition assessment of all the City's 50 lift stations. Trotter and Associates ranked 10 lift stations for priority rehabilitation or replacement. The first of the ten priority lift stations, Lawrence Avenue Lift Station, is currently in construction phase. The next two priority lift stations, Greenfield Lift Station, and Benton Lift Station, are planned for replacement in 2023.
Trotter and Associates provided a proposal for detailed design engineering for the Greenfield Lift Station and the Benton Lift Station. Staff reviewed Trotter and Associates' proposal and could not come to an agreement on pricing. Staff then asked the next two top rated firms, Strand Associates, Inc. and Donahue & Associates, Inc. to provide a proposal for design engineering of the Greenfield Lift Station and Benton Lift Station.
